What Type of Medicine is Litanin? (Identity and Classification)

Litanin is a pharmaceutical agent defined by its single active substance, Cyclobutyrol, and is pharmacologically classified as a synthetic hydrocholeretic agent utilized in the field of bile and liver therapy. The substance Cyclobutyrol is identified chemically as alpha-Ethyl-1-hydroxycyclohexaneacetic acid, which is a hydroxy monocarboxylic acid. The drug is formally designated by the Anatomical Therapeutic Chemical (ATC) system under the code A05AX03, classifying it as one of the specialized medicines for bile therapy. This classification confirms Litanin's role as a monocomponent, specialized, synthetic agent aimed at supporting hepatic function and bile production.

Cyclobutyrol: Composition and Form

The core component of Litanin is Cyclobutyrol, the International Nonproprietary Name (INN) for the active substance, which is frequently prepared in pharmaceutical manufacturing as its stable derivative, Cyclobutyrol sodium. Litanin is exclusively a single-ingredient product, and it is formulated for oral administration, meaning it is typically available as a tablet or capsule—a solid pharmaceutical preparation. This form necessitates combining the active substance with standard solid pharmaceutical excipients, confirming its design as a systemic medicine intended for absorption through the gastrointestinal tract to exert its effect internally on the liver.

General Purpose: Supporting Bile Flow (High-Level Mechanism)

The overall purpose of Litanin is to support healthy bile flow by increasing the volume of bile secreted by the liver, an action known as the choleretic effect. This specific action is characterized as hydrocholeresis because it involves the stimulation of a larger, more fluid-rich volume of bile. The compound's action is characterized by its capacity to modify bile properties and promote fluid secretion. This action helps to improve the general clearance and flow within the biliary ducts, which is the foundational therapeutic benefit of the drug in hepatobiliary management.

Mechanism of Action

Bile Acid-Independent Hydrocholeresis

Litanin's mechanism centers on its active ingredient, Cyclobutyrol, which is actively excreted by liver cells into the bile ductules. This process creates a powerful osmotic gradient that forces a large influx of water and electrolytes into the bile. This core action, known as hydrocholeresis, results in a significantly increased volume and flow rate of bile, increasing the hepatobiliary flow rate independently of the body's natural bile acid secretion pathways.

Modulation of Biliary Composition

The drug exerts a simultaneous, distinct effect by modulating the biliary lipid transport pathway. This action reduces the secretion of fatty components, primarily cholesterol and phospholipids, into the secreted bile. The physiological consequence of this dual action—high water content coupled with low lipid content—is a reduction in bile viscosity (rheology), resulting in highly fluid bile and contributing to bile flow dynamics within the biliary passages.

️ Constraint of Liver Secretory Function

The entire mechanism of action is critically dependent on the active secretory function of the liver cell transporters. If the liver's ability to actively excrete the Cyclobutyrol anion is impaired, the necessary osmotic drive cannot be generated. This physiological constraint means the hydrocholeretic effect is directly correlated with the residual transport competence of the liver cells.
